How they compare
Morocco currently reports 0.1% against 0.1% in Ghana, a difference of 0.0%.
That makes Morocco's figure about 1.1 times Ghana's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Ghana ahead.
Ghana ranks 121st and Morocco ranks 120th of 213 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Ghana averaged higher in 2 and Morocco in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ghana | Morocco |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.2% | 0.0% | 0.2% | Ghana |
| 2010s | 0.2% | 0.0% | 0.1% | Ghana |
| 2020s | 0.1% | 0.1% | 0.0% | Morocco |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
